What is a Remote Non Clinical Radiologist?

A Remote Non Clinical Radiologist is a medical professional with radiology training who works outside of traditional clinical settings, often from home or another remote location. Instead of diagnosing patients directly, they may focus on tasks such as consulting, research, teaching, medical imaging analysis for research or AI development, or providing expertise for insurance or legal cases. This role allows radiologists to use their expertise without direct patient care, offering greater flexibility and often better work-life balance. The demand for remote non clinical radiologists has increased with advancements in technology and telemedicine.

How does a remote non-clinical radiologist typically collaborate with clinical teams and other healthcare professionals?

Remote non-clinical radiologists often work closely with clinical teams through secure digital platforms, providing expert consultation, second opinions, and supporting quality assurance initiatives. Communication is typically facilitated via video conferences, emails, or specialized medical software, allowing for timely feedback and information sharing. Building strong relationships with referring physicians, technologists, and administrative staff is essential, as it ensures efficient workflow and accurate interpretation of imaging data. While there is less face-to-face interaction, strong communication skills and responsiveness are key to effective collaboration in this remote environ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Non Clinical Radiologist, and why are they important?

To excel as a Remote Non Clinical Radiologist, you need a medical degree with specialty training in radiology, a valid medical license, and expertise in interpreting medical images. Familiarity with Picture Archiving and Communication Systems (PACS), teleradiology software, and standardized reporting systems is essential. Strong attention to detail, critical thinking, and effective written communication are vital soft skills for providing accurate consults and reports remotely. These competencies ensure precise diagnoses, efficient workflow, and high-quality patient care in a virtual setting.
